This evocative photograph captures the aftermath of the Monastir Offensive during the First World War, specifically the looting of the safes in the burned prefecture by German troops in 1916. The image, titled "Les Allies a Monastir; Les coffres-forts pillés par les Allemands dans la préfecture incendiée" (The Allies in Monastir; Safes looted by Germans in the burned prefecture), is from the "Collection de la Guerre IV" of the French publication "L'Illustration" (The Illustration). The scene unfolds in the courtyard of the prefecture, with debris and wreckage scattered about. A man in military uniform stands in the foreground, his expression unreadable as he gazes upon the open safe before him. The safe, along with others, has been plundered, its contents likely taken as spoils of war. The Monastir Offensive, also known as the Salonika Front or the Macedonian Front, was a significant campaign on the Eastern Front of World War I, fought between the Allied Powers and the Central Powers in the region of Monastir, Macedonia. The photograph serves as a poignant reminder of the destruction and lawlessness that often accompanied military conflict, and the human cost of war.
